- MirakeMay 09, 2023 · 2 years agoOne potential risk associated with different reward distribution models in the world of cryptocurrency is the concentration of power. In some models, a small group of participants may end up controlling a significant portion of the rewards, leading to centralization and potential manipulation of the system. This can undermine the decentralization and trust that cryptocurrencies aim to achieve. Additionally, certain reward distribution models may incentivize short-term profit-seeking behavior, which can lead to market volatility and instability. It is important to carefully consider the potential risks and drawbacks of different reward distribution models to ensure the long-term sustainability and fairness of the cryptocurrency ecosystem.
